An interior design student from K-State is conducting a research study on the role of interior lighting in supporting individuals with low vision. Jordan De Tar Newbert is seeking volunteers who are living with low vision issues who will let her take light meter readings of targeted areas of their living environments. She will also want to ask some questions about how light works (or doesn't work) in the home. Key areas include: kitchen, dining area, work areas (such as desks), and the bathroom. If you are interested, attend one of the three informational sessions at noon or 5 p.m. Monday, Sept. 30, or 5 p.m. Wednesday, Oct. 2, in the Living Room.
